| package com.google.devtools.build.lib.buildeventservice.client; |
| |
| import com.google.common.base.Function; |
| import com.google.common.util.concurrent.ListenableFuture; |
| import com.google.devtools.build.v1.PublishBuildToolEventStreamRequest; |
| import com.google.devtools.build.v1.PublishBuildToolEventStreamResponse; |
| import com.google.devtools.build.v1.PublishLifecycleEventRequest; |
| import io.grpc.Status; |
| |
| /** Interface used to abstract both gRPC and Stubby BuildEventServiceBackend. */ |
| public interface BuildEventServiceClient { |
| |
| /** |
| * Makes a synchronous RPC that publishes the specified lifecycle event. |
| * |
| * @param lifecycleEvent Event to be published. |
| * @return Status of the RPC. |
| */ |
| Status publish(PublishLifecycleEventRequest lifecycleEvent) throws Exception; |
| |
| /** |
| * Starts a new stream with the given ack callback. Throws an {@link IllegalStateException} if the |
| * there is already opened stream. Callers should wait on the returned Future in order to |
| * guarantee that all callback calls have been received. |
| * |
| * @param ackCallback Consumer called every time a ack message is received. |
| * @return Listenable future that blocks until the onDone callback is called. |
| * @throws Exception |
| */ |
| ListenableFuture<Status> openStream( |
| Function<PublishBuildToolEventStreamResponse, Void> ackCallback) throws Exception; |
| |
| /** |
| * Sends an event to the most recently opened stream. This method may block due to flow control. |
| * |
| * @param buildEvent Event that should be sent. |
| * @throws Exception |
| */ |
| void sendOverStream(PublishBuildToolEventStreamRequest buildEvent) throws Exception; |
| |
| /** |
| * Closes the currently opened opened stream. This method does not block. Callers should block on |
| * the Future returned by {@link #openStream(Function)} in order to make sure that all |
| * ackCallback calls have been received. |
| */ |
| void closeStream(); |
| |
| /** |
| * Closes the currently opened stream with error. This method does not block. Callers should block |
| * on the Future returned by {@link #openStream(Function)} if in order to make sure that all |
| * ackCallback calls have been received. This method is NOOP if the stream was already finished. |
| */ |
| void abortStream(Status status); |
| |
| /** |
| * Checks if there is a currently active stream. |
| * |
| * @return True if the current stream is active, false otherwise. |
| */ |
| boolean isStreamActive(); |
| |
| /** |
| * Called once to dispose resources that this client might be holding (such as thread pools). This |
| * should be the last method called on this object. |
| * |
| * @throws InterruptedException |
| */ |
| void shutdown() throws InterruptedException; |
| |
| /** |
| * If possible, returns a user readable error message for a given {@link Throwable}. |
| * |
| * <p>As a last resort, it's valid to return {@link Throwable#getMessage()}. |
| */ |
| String userReadableError(Throwable t); |
| } |
